"Without skipping a beat, David Kay says to kill their scientists. Two years later, remember those motorcyclists who would roll in, put a sticky bomb in the window. That started happening."
At a 2000s-era meeting at the Willard Hotel near the White House, UN weapons inspector David Kay recommended bombing Iran during daytime specifically to kill scientists, despite nighttime strikes being standard military doctrine. The guest, then a fly on the wall at the meeting, witnessed this exchange with Defense Secretary Ash Carter. Years later, targeted assassinations of Iranian scientists began occurring exactly as discussed.
